d20f3c9e 16 - reyk@cvs.openbsd.org 2005/12/06 22:38:28
17 [auth-options.c auth-options.h channels.c channels.h clientloop.c]
18 [misc.c misc.h readconf.c readconf.h scp.c servconf.c servconf.h]
19 [serverloop.c sftp.c ssh.1 ssh.c ssh_config ssh_config.5 sshconnect.c]
20 [sshconnect.h sshd.8 sshd_config sshd_config.5]
21 Add support for tun(4) forwarding over OpenSSH, based on an idea and
22 initial channel code bits by markus@. This is a simple and easy way to
23 use OpenSSH for ad hoc virtual private network connections, e.g.
24 administrative tunnels or secure wireless access. It's based on a new
25 ssh channel and works similar to the existing TCP forwarding support,
26 except that it depends on the tun(4) network interface on both ends of
27 the connection for layer 2 or layer 3 tunneling. This diff also adds
28 support for LocalCommand in the ssh(1) client.
d20f3c9e 29 ok djm@, markus@, jmc@ (manpages), tested and discussed with others

a4f24bf8 45 - reyk@cvs.openbsd.org 2005/12/08 18:34:11
46 [auth-options.c includes.h misc.c misc.h readconf.c servconf.c]
47 [serverloop.c ssh.c ssh_config.5 sshd_config.5 configure.ac]
48 two changes to the new ssh tunnel support. this breaks compatibility
49 with the initial commit but is required for a portable approach.
50 - make the tunnel id u_int and platform friendly, use predefined types.
51 - support configuration of layer 2 (ethernet) or layer 3
52 (point-to-point, default) modes. configuration is done using the
53 Tunnel (yes|point-to-point|ethernet|no) option is ssh_config(5) and
54 restricted by the PermitTunnel (yes|point-to-point|ethernet|no) option
55 in sshd_config(5).
56 ok djm@, man page bits by jmc@
